Chapter Nine
“Mommy, is Jordan going to be my new daddy?” Dani asked the following morning while shoving her French toast around in a puddle of syrup.
The unexpected question brought up the subject that had kept Kelly awake all night long.
“If he has his way, he is,” Kelly muttered before she could catch herself.
She hadn’t anticipated getting into this before she’d even had her first cup of coffee. In fact, she hadn’t intended to get into it with her daughter at all, at least not until the matter was more settled with Jordan himself.
“When?”
“That’s hard to say, sweetie. There are some things we have to work out.”
“Like what?”
Kelly thought of all the doubts that had chased through her mind. None of them were things she could share with her daughter. “Just things,” she said evasively.
Dani studied her intently and apparently concluded Kelly still wasn’t convinced that Jordan would make a proper daddy. “I like Jordan,” she informed her mother firmly. “I think he would make a very good daddy.”
Kelly wondered if her daughter had insights into Jordan that hadn’t come to her yet. “Why is that?” she asked.
“He brings me candy.”
Kelly refrained from labeling the candy what it was—bribery. Hadn’t he tried the very same tactic on her? She’d already told Jordan half a dozen times to cut it out or he’d be paying Dani’s dental bills.
“Don’t you like Jordan?” Dani inquired worriedly. “You used to be bestest friends, that’s what you said.”
“Most of the time I like him very much,” Kelly conceded.
“More than Daddy?”
Ah, now there was a mine field if ever Kelly had seen one. She had prepared an answer to that long ago, knowing sooner or later that rather plaintive question or one very similar was going to come up. Dani was too precocious not to ask difficult questions about the man who had sired her but spent very little time in her life.
“Your father is a fine man,” she said, almost by rote. “He and I just weren’t well suited. We were very young and we made a mistake getting married.”
Dani contemplated that for a while, then turned a troubled look on Kelly. “Was I a mistake, too?”
Tears sprang to Kelly’s eyes. She wrapped Dani in a hug and squeezed, peppering her worried little face with kisses. “Never, not in a million years. You are the very best part of my life. I wanted you more than anything.”
“Daddy, too? Did he want me more than anything?”
Kelly cursed the man she’d once been married to for putting her on more tricky turf. Paul had never been inclined to have children, had agreed to Kelly getting pregnant only after frequent arguments. It had been yet another mistake on Kelly’s part. She had thought Paul would love being a father, once he’d gotten over being terrified by the idea of it. She’d been convinced he would take to it. He hadn’t. It was one reason she’d watched Jordan’s behavior with Dani so closely, one reason she had fretted over how well the two of them would get along.
